Supplies Used:
Stamps: Stampin UP! Teeny Tiny Wishes and Valentine Defined, Pink Persimmon Banner (Small), Market Street Stamps Simply Stitched Borders
Paper: Stampin UP Real Red, Whisper White, Pacific Point and Bashful Blue, Stampin UP Celebrations DSP
Ink: Stampin UP Real Red, Pacific Point, Pear Pizzazz, and Bashful Blue
Ribbon: Stampin UP! White Grosgrain and the Twinery Maraschino
